global warming issues and solutions

 Global warming is the long-term warming of the planet due to the increasing levels of greenhouse gases in the atmosphere. Greenhouse gases, such as carbon dioxide and methane, trap heat from the sun and prevent it from escaping into space, causing the planet to warm. The main cause of global warming is the burning of fossil fuels, such as coal and oil, which releases large amounts of carbon dioxide into the atmosphere. Deforestation, industrial processes, and agriculture also contribute to the increasing levels of greenhouse gases in the atmosphere.

There are several solutions to global warming. One solution is to reduce the use of fossil fuels and instead rely on renewable energy sources, such as solar and wind power. This can be done by increasing the use of renewable energy and by implementing policies and incentives that encourage the use of clean energy.

Another solution is to increase energy efficiency by using more efficient technologies and appliances and by adopting more energy-efficient practices. This can help to reduce the overall demand for energy, which in turn can reduce greenhouse gas emissions.

Other solutions to global warming include reforestation and afforestation, which can help to remove carbon dioxide from the atmosphere, and carbon capture and storage technologies, which can capture and store carbon dioxide emissions from power plants and other industrial sources.

It is important for governments, businesses, and individuals to take action to address global warming and to adopt more sustainable practices in order to protect the planet and ensure a healthy future for all.
